Iowa Cold-Case Murder Defendant Released on Reduced Bond With House Arrest

Letters from 52 supporters persuaded the judge to reduce bail.

Overview

  • Kristin Ramsey posted $50,000 on Thursday and left the Dallas County Jail under house arrest with GPS monitoring and no guns allowed at her home.
  • The judge cut her bail from $2 million to $500,000 after noting her clean record, long ties to Iowa, and strong community support.
  • She has pleaded not guilty to a grand jury indictment, with a June 19 hearing set and a jury trial scheduled for January 2027.
  • Defense lawyers say police lost or destroyed case material over the years and have asked for a full accounting and all records through discovery.
  • Court filings cite a neighbor who heard two shots and saw Ramsey outside the model home, and searches at her house that turned up firearms, illegal drugs, and violent posters.
